When Maxwell released his sophomore album, Embrya , in 1998, it was met with both confusion and eventual reverence. Following the massive success of Maxwell's Urban Hang Suite , he avoided the safe path of radio-friendly R&B to craft a complex, aquatic, and deeply atmospheric world.
